The Anatomy Department was founded in 1983, as a division of the Department of Medicine in the NCKU Medical College. The first head of the institute was Prof. Ching-LiangShen (沈清良). From 1994 to 1997, Prof. Shi-Yuan Yang (楊西苑) was the head of the institute. From 1997 to 2000 Prof. Ching-Liang Shen (沈清良) returned and served as institute head again. In the year 2000, the name of the department was changed to the Institute of Cell Biology and Anatomy. Prof. Shur-Tzu Chen (陳淑姿) was the head of this new institute from 2000 to 2003. After 2000, the new institute began a Master’s program. From 2003 to 2006 Prof. Chin-Hsien Chien (簡基憲) administered the institute. From 2006 to 2012, Prof. Bu-Miin Huang (黃步敏), is serving as the head of the institute .From 2012 to2015 Professor Yu-Min Kuo(郭余民) was the head of the institute. From 8/1/2015, Professor Chun-I Sze(司君一) is the head of the institute. Since 2001, the institute began accepting students in the PhD program from the Institute of Basic Medical Research in theNCKU Medical College.
